Illinois HB 5468 (98th) — WINDOW TINT CERTIFICATION

Amends the Illinois Vehicle Code. Provides that persons with medical certificates allowing tinted windows only need to renew their medical certificate every 4 years, rather than annually.

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2014-02-11 Filed with the Clerk by Rep. Charles E. Meier filing
  • 2014-02-13 First Reading reading-1
  • 2014-02-13 Referred to Rules Committee referral-committee
  • 2014-02-27 Assigned to Transportation: Vehicles & Safety Committee referral-committee
  • 2014-03-05 Added Chief Co-Sponsor Rep. Rich Brauer
  • 2014-03-05 Do Pass / Short Debate Transportation: Vehicles & Safety Committee; 009-000-000 committee-passage
  • 2014-03-05 Placed on Calendar 2nd Reading - Short Debate
  • 2014-03-19 Second Reading - Short Debate reading-2
  • 2014-03-19 Placed on Calendar Order of 3rd Reading - Short Debate
  • 2014-03-21 Third Reading - Short Debate - Passed 110-000-000 reading-3, passage
  • 2014-03-21 Added Chief Co-Sponsor Rep. David R. Leitch
  • 2014-03-21 Arrive in Senate introduction
  • 2014-03-21 Placed on Calendar Order of First Reading March 25, 2014 reading-1
  • 2014-03-21 Chief Senate Sponsor Sen. Kyle McCarter
  • 2014-03-25 First Reading reading-1
  • 2014-03-25 Referred to Assignments referral-committee
  • 2014-04-30 Assigned to Transportation referral-committee
  • 2014-05-07 Do Pass Transportation; 012-000-000 committee-passage
  • 2014-05-07 Placed on Calendar Order of 2nd Reading May 8, 2014
  • 2014-05-08 Second Reading reading-2
  • 2014-05-08 Placed on Calendar Order of 3rd Reading May 12, 2014
  • 2014-05-22 Third Reading - Passed; 056-000-000 reading-3, passage
  • 2014-05-22 Passed Both Houses
  • 2014-06-20 Sent to the Governor executive-receipt
  • 2014-07-16 Governor Approved executive-signature
  • 2014-07-16 Effective Date January 1, 2015
  • 2014-07-16 Public Act . . . . . . . . . 98-0737 became-law
